INVERCARGILL
AND SOUTHLAND TRAMPING AND WALKING TRACKS
Borland
Road routes
The
Green Lake/Lake Monowai track is a five-day circuit.
The route to the North Borland Hut provides a clear
view of Mt Titiroa.
Category: Route
Borland
Road tramping tracks
Borland
Road and nearby tramping opportunities provides
access to Lake Monowai, Lake Manapouri and their
tributary rivers which provide good trout fishing.
Category: Tramping track
Borland
Road walking tracks
Borland
Road provides access to The Peninsula Lookout overlooking
Lake Monowai and the Borland Nature Walk.
Category: Walking track
Control
Gates to Dock Bay, Brod Bay & Mt Luxmore
From
Te Anau township trampers can walk sections of the
Kepler track, from a 30 minutes walk to Dock Bay
to a more demanding day tramp to Mt Luxmore and
back.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Control
Gates to Rainbow Reach Walk
This
track follows the Waiau river near Te Anau township
going through red and mountain beech forest.
Category: Walking track
Completion Time: 2 hr
30 min - 3 hr 30 min
Croydon
Bush tramping tracks
There
are several tramping opportunities available on
marked routes that are maintained by the Hokonui
Tramping Club.
Category: Tramping track
Croydon
Bush walking tracks
There
are several walking tracks within Croydon Bush,
which are are maintained by the Department of Conservation,
Gore District Council and Hokonui Tramping Club.
Category: Walking track
Dusky
Track
The
Dusky Track offers trampers a challenging 84 km
tramping track which requires at least eight days
to complete.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 84 km
Completion Time: 8 -
9 days
Dusky
Track
Dusky
Track spans two areas. This link will take you to
the information about the track, in the Te Anau
area.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 84 km
Completion Time: 8 -
9 days
Eyre
Mountains/Taka Ra Haka routes
A
spectacular conservation park in the Eyre Mountains/Taka
Ra Haka for the more adventurous tramper, hunter
or trout fisher.
Category: Route
Alert: The track into
Mount Bee (Eyre Mountains) will be closed to the
public effective 14 November 2007 until further
notice, due to logging operations.
Garnock
Burn Track
Several
tracks start on the eastern shores of Lake Manapouri.
These are suited to day trips and easy two or three
day tramps.
Category: Tramping track
George
Sound Track
This
track is suitable for fit, experienced and well
equipped trampers only.
Category: Route
Completion Time: 2 -
3 days
Hollyford
Track
The
Hollyford Track is the only major track in Fiordland
at low altitude which can be walked in any season
and also connects to the Fiordland coastline.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 56 km
Completion Time: 4 days
one way
Hump
Ridge Track
The
Hump Ridge Track provides a wide variety of scenery
during this three day/two night walking experience.
The track is managed by the Tuatapere Hump Ridge
Track Trust.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Distance: 53 km
Completion Time: 3 days
Kepler
Track
Traversing
through spectacular scenery in Fiordland National
Park, the 60 km Kepler Track is a moderate walking
track that takes three to four days to complete.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Distance: 60 km
Completion Time: 3 -
4 days
Key
Summit Track
Accessed
from Milford Road the Key Summit track follows a
section of the Routeburn Track and is an ideal introduction
the impressive scenery and natural features of Fiordland
National Park.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Completion Time: 3 hr
return
Lake
Marian
Lake
Marian is in a hanging valley, formed by glacial
action, and is one of the most beautiful settings
in Fiordland.
Category: Tramping track
Completion Time: 3 hr
return
Mavora
- Greenstone Walkway
This
is a 50 km, four day tramping trip, linking the
Mavora Lakes Camping Area with the Greenstone Track.
It passes through open valley tussock land and beech
forested hill country.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 50 km
Completion Time: 4 days
Milford
Road short walks
Lake
Gunn, the Mirror Lakes and the Piopiotahi/Milford
Sound Foreshore Walk are some of the short walks
reached from Milford Road, and giving visitors a
taste of the natural features of the area.
Category: Short walk
Milford
Track
Beginning
at the head of Lake Te Anau and ending at Milford
Sound, the 53.5 km Milford Track is in the heart
of spectacular Fiordland National Park.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Distance: 53.5 km
Completion Time: 4 days
Monument
Track
Boat
access is required to the start of the Monument
Track. It's a short, but challenging 290-metre climb
to the summit.
Category: Tramping track
Completion Time: 1 hr
30 min - 2 hr return
North
West Circuit Stewart Island/Rakiura
The
North West Circuit offers challenging tramping around
Rakiura/Stewart island�s northern coast.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 125 km
Completion Time: 9 -
11 days
Piano
Flat & Wakiaia Forest tramping tracks
Waikaia
Forest is a large island of beech forest, nestled
in the mountain farmlands of northern Southland.
Piano Flat, a grassy enclosure at the southern end,
provides a picnic area, camping ground and several
walking tracks.
Category: Tramping track
Pyke
- Big Bay Route
The
Pyke - Big Bay Route is a low altitude, strenuous
60 km route, suitable for experienced and well
equipped parties.
Category: Route
Distance: 60 km
Rainbow
Reach to Shallow Bay Walk
A
walk to Shallow Bay is a full day tramp from Te
Anau township and gives visitors a taste of the
Kepler Track.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Completion Time: 8 -
10 hr
Rakiura
Track
The
Rakiura Track Great Walk is found on Stewart Island/Rakiura,
just a 20 minute flight from Invercargill or
an hour by ferry from Bluff.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Distance: 36 km
Completion Time: 3 days
Routeburn
Track
Traversing
32 km through Mount Aspiring National Park and Fiordland
National Park, the Routeburn Track can be walked
in conjunction with the Greenstone or Caples tracks.
Category: Great Walk/Easy
tramping track
Distance: 32 km
Completion Time: 3 days
Snowdon
Forest tramping tracks
Snowdon
Forest tramping tracks are used infrequently and
many are marked routes only. The Mararoa, Whitestone
and Upukerora Rivers offer good fishing for rainbow
trout.
Category: Tramping track
South
Mavora Lake walking tracks
Looking
for day walks from the Mavora Lakes camping ground
in the Te Anau area? Try the South Mavora Lake Walking
Track or the track to the Kiwiburn Hut.
Category: Walking track
Southern
Circuit Stewart Island/Rakiura
The
Southern Circuit is regarded as a remote, challenging
tramp needing good fitness and route-finding skills.
You can get to it via the North West Circuit Track
or by boat.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 71.5 km round
trip
Completion Time: 4 -
6 days round trip from Freshwater
Stewart
Island/Rakiura day walks
There
are a number of walking track category day walks
that start at Halfmoon Bay on Stewart Island/Rakiura.
Category: Walking track
Stockyard
Cove Track
Stockyard
Cove Track is a short walk from Stockyard Cove in
Hope Arm, Lake Manapouri.
Category: Walking track
Completion Time: 45
min - 1 hr return
Takitimu
Mountains routes
Challenging
routes traverse the forest area of Takitimu Mountains
taking you to Aparima Forks Hut or Spence Hut.
Category: Route
Te
Anau area short walks
If
you have less than a day to spend there are a number
of short walks to enjoy in the Te Anau area including
a visit to the Te Anau Wildlife Centre.
Category: Short walk
Te
Anau visitor centre walking tracks
If
you are pressed for time 1 - 2 hour walking tracks
to the Lake Te Anau control gates or Upukerora River
can be enjoyed starting from Te Anau township.
Category: Walking track
Teal
Bay Route
The
Teal Bay Route links Te Waewae Bay with Lake Hauroko
in Fiordland National Park.
Category: Tramping track
Ulva
Island walking tracks
Managed
by DOC as an open sanctuary, Ulva Island is one
of several small islands inside Paterson Inlet,
Stewart Island/Rakiura, and has a number of walking
tracks for you to enjoy.
Category: Walking track
Wairaurahiri
to Waitutu track - South Coast track
This
part of the South Coast Track begins at the Wairaurahiri
Hut beside the river. Nearby Waitutu Lodge is across
the swingbridge and all just a few metres from the
south coast.
Category: Tramping track
Distance: 13 km
Completion Time: 4 -
6 hr
Waitutu
River to Big River route - South Coast track
The
South Coast Track begins at Te Waewae Bay and extends
west to Big River. This stretch is a challenging
route mainly following the old telephone line which
linked Puysegur Point to Orepuki.
Category: Route
Distance: 12 km
Completion Time: 5 -
7 hr |
